Overview

A stubborn stage actor navigates single fatherhood, a strenuous theatre project, an adulterous love affair, and the confounding dreams awakened by a puzzling street encounter with a mysterious stranger.

How It Feels

Read from this film's synopsis, keywords and credits, and used to work out what it sits beside.

A man's carefully compartmentalised life, fatherhood, performance, romance, begins to fray when a cryptic stranger appears, drawing him into a spiral of interlocking confusion and desire. It's a puzzle-box of a film that pairs intimate character study with disquieting mystery.
